Jack Banta
Jackie Kay Banta
Bats: Left , Throws: Right
Weight: 175 lb.

Born: June 24, 1925 in Hutchinson, KS
High School: Hutchinson (Hutchinson, KS)
Signed
by the Brooklyn Dodgers as an amateur free agent in 1944. (All Transactions)
Debut: September 18, 1947
Final Game: June 21, 1950
Died: September 17, 2006 in Hutchinson, KS
